Output e8597333b304d93189fa4b884f053cbd5a477af2b7c7a7b497d0e72b08c10a1e:0

value
21392665351
script pubkey
OP_0 OP_PUSHBYTES_20 175ec4bf8389644560016fca866d85edcc4da179
address
ltc1qza0vf0ur39jy2cqpdl9gvmv9ahxymgtefm9c8h
transaction
e8597333b304d93189fa4b884f053cbd5a477af2b7c7a7b497d0e72b08c10a1e
spent
true